John Thomas BORNEMAN

Regimental number2795
Place of birthBendigo, Victoria
ReligionCongregational
OccupationFarmer
AddressMincha East, Victoria
Marital statusSingle
Age at embarkation23
Height5' 8"
Weight172 lbs
Next of kinFather, A Borneman, Mincha East, Victoria
Previous military serviceNil
Enlistment date7 July 1915
Place of enlistmentMelbourne, Victoria
Rank on enlistmentPrivate
Unit name8th Battalion, 9th Reinforcement
AWM Embarkation Roll number23/25/3
Embarkation detailsUnit embarked from Melbourne, Victoria, on board SS Makarini on 15 September 1915
Rank from Nominal RollPrivate
Unit from Nominal Roll5th Machine Gun Battalion
Other details from Roll of Honour CircularEnlisted 7 July 1915. Taken on strength, 8th Bn, Gallipoli, 7 December 1915. Transferred to 60th Bn, 22 February 1916; to 15 Machine Gun Company, 12 March 1916.
FateKilled in Action 19 July 1916
Place of death or woundingFromelles, France
Date of death19 July 1916
Age at death24
Place of burialRue-Du-Bois Military Cemetery (Plot II, Row A, Grave No. 1), Fleurbaix, France
Panel number, Roll of Honour,
  Australian War Memorial
177
Family/military connectionsBrother: 14655 Pte Albert BORNEMAN MM, CdeG, 5th Field Artillery Brigade, returned to Australia, 23 March 1919.
Other details

War service: Egypt, Gallipoli, Western Front

Medals: 1914-15 Star, British War Medal, Victory Medal
